<?xml version="1.0" encoding="utf-8"?>
<!-- generator="FeedCreator 1.7.2-ppt DokuWiki" -->
<?xml-stylesheet href="http://phpcompiler.net/lib/styles/feed.css" type="text/css"?>
<rdf:RDF
    xmlns="http://purl.org/rss/1.0/"
    x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
    x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
    xmlns:dc="http://purl.org/dc/elements/1.1/">
    <channel rdf:about="http://phpcompiler.net/feed.php">
        <title>Phalanger core</title>
        <description></description>
        <link>http://phpcompiler.net/</link>
        <image rdf:resource="http://phpcompiler.net/lib/images/favicon.ico" />
       <dc:date>2010-09-03T19:43:44+01:00</dc:date>
        <items>
            <rdf:Seq>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aauthors&amp;amp;rev=1268423372"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3abenchmarks&amp;amp;rev=1166244244"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3acommunity&amp;amp;rev=1268429818"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3acontributing&amp;amp;rev=1166285067"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3afeatures&amp;amp;rev=1166233862"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3ahistory&amp;amp;rev=1166284629"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aoverview&amp;amp;rev=1166230590"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aphalanger_for_.net_developers&amp;amp;rev=1175479397"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aphalanger_for_mono_users&amp;amp;rev=1168201511"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aphalanger_for_php_developers&amp;amp;rev=1167358267"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aphalanger_net_screenshot&amp;amp;rev=1168202883"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aphp-in-vs2008&amp;amp;rev=1205290479"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aphpbb-benchmark&amp;amp;rev=1166235376"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aprevious-version&amp;amp;rev=1166284911"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3aroadmap&amp;amp;rev=1177249624"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3asidebar&amp;amp;rev=1166840036"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3astart&amp;amp;rev=1268428153"/>
                <rdf:li rdf:resource="http://phpcompiler.net/doku.php?id=core%3atalks&amp;amp;rev=1166241246"/>
            </rdf:Seq>
        </items>
    </channel>
    <image rdf:about="http://phpcompiler.net/lib/images/favicon.ico">
        <title>Phalanger</title>
        <link>http://phpcompiler.net/</link>
        <url>http://phpcompiler.net/lib/images/favicon.ico</url>
    </image>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aauthors&amp;amp;rev=1268423372">
        <dc:format>text/html</dc:format>
        <dc:date>2010-03-12T20:49:32+01:00</dc:date>
        <title>core:authors</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aauthors&amp;amp;rev=1268423372</link>
        <description>Current Team Members

	*  Tomas Petricek  (&lt;tomas@tomasp.net&gt;, &lt;http://tomasp.net&gt;, MSN: tomas@eeeksoft.net), Tomas is the current project administrator and developer lead - contact him if you are interested in working on Phalanger ;-) or if you have any questions regarding the project.
	*  Jan Seda (jan[dot]seda[at]skilldrive[dot]com), - Jan is making sure that large PHP projects work well on Phalanger. 
	*  Adam Abonyi - Adam is working on projects related to Phalanger
	*  Dan Balas - Dan is w…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3abenchmarks&amp;amp;rev=1166244244">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:benchmarks</title>
        <link>http://phpcompiler.net/doku.php?id=core%3abenchmarks&amp;amp;rev=1166244244</link>
        <description>Contents of this page:

	*  
	*  

Micro-benchmarks for the latest release

The first benchmark measures behavior of Phalanger and PHP in specific very often used operations:

 (Click on the image for full version)

The Y axis shows time required to complete the operation. Each operation was performed 10M times in a loop on  Pentium M Dothan 1.8GHz/2MB cache, Windows XP. This test compares standard PHP implementation, Phalanger 1.0 (running on .NET 1.1) and the latest Phalanger 2.0 (on .NET 2.0)…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3acommunity&amp;amp;rev=1268429818">
        <dc:format>text/html</dc:format>
        <dc:date>2010-03-12T22:36:58+01:00</dc:date>
        <title>core:community</title>
        <link>http://phpcompiler.net/doku.php?id=core%3acommunity&amp;amp;rev=1268429818</link>
        <description>Forums / Mailing notifications

 The primary discussion forum for Phalanger community members is the forum on &lt;http://phalanger.codeplex.com/Thread/List.aspx&gt;. If you want to subscribe by an email be informed by an email you can check how on &lt;http://www.codeplex.com/wikipage?ProjectName=CodePlex&amp;title=Mailing%20Lists&amp;referringTitle=CodePlex%20Documentation#Subscribe&gt;</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3acontributing&amp;amp;rev=1166285067">
        <dc:format>text/html</dc:format>
        <dc:date>2006-12-16T17:04:27+01:00</dc:date>
        <title>core:contributing</title>
        <link>http://phpcompiler.net/doku.php?id=core%3acontributing&amp;amp;rev=1166285067</link>
        <description>Are you interested in the project and would like to contribute? Do not hesitate to contact us. We are seeking for skilled and passionate people who would like to improve Phalanger in any way. There is a plenty of opportunities for participation including the following:</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3afeatures&amp;amp;rev=1166233862">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:features</title>
        <link>http://phpcompiler.net/doku.php?id=core%3afeatures&amp;amp;rev=1166233862</link>
        <description>Makes PHP first-class citizen in the .NET languages family

	*  Compiles PHP language to the MSIL (Microsoft Intermediate Language), which is a byte-code assembly used by the .NET CLR
	*  Allows using .NET objects from the PHP language thanks to the PHP/CLR Language Extensions
	*  Enables using libraries written in PHP from other .NET languages</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3ahistory&amp;amp;rev=1166284629">
        <dc:format>text/html</dc:format>
        <dc:date>2006-12-16T16:57:09+01:00</dc:date>
        <title>core:history</title>
        <link>http://phpcompiler.net/doku.php?id=core%3ahistory&amp;amp;rev=1166284629</link>
        <description>The Phalanger project started at the beginning of the year 2003 as a student project code-named PHP.NET at Faculty of Mathematics and Physics, Charles University in Prague, Czech Republic.

Tomas Matousek, Ladislav Prosek, Vaclav Novak, Pavel Novak, Jan Benda, and Martin Maly have worked on the project under the supervision of Jan Stoklasa (jan dot stoklasa at gmail dot com), who was also an adviser and the idea supporter, and Vojtech Jakl. The aim of the project was to find out whether the comp…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aoverview&amp;amp;rev=1166230590">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:overview</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aoverview&amp;amp;rev=1166230590</link>
        <description>Phalanger is a new PHP implementation introducing the PHP language into the family of compiled .NET languages. It provides PHP applications an execution environment that is fast and extremely compatible with the vast array of existing PHP code. Phalanger gives web-application developers the ability to benefit from both the ease-of-use and effectiveness of the PHP language and the power and richness of the .NET platform taking profit from the best from both sides.</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aphalanger_for_.net_developers&amp;amp;rev=1175479397">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:phalanger_for_.net_developers</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aphalanger_for_.net_developers&amp;amp;rev=1175479397</link>
        <description>Downloads

	*  [Download sample projects for this article]

Contents

Phalanger is a PHP language compiler for Microsoft .NET platform. In the 1.0 version the primary goal was to be able to compile any existing PHP application, but in the 2.0 version of Phalanger, PHP became first-class .NET citizen. In this article we’d like to describe the most important and interesting features in the Phalanger project from .NET developers point of view. This means that we will focus a bit more on .NET, inter…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aphalanger_for_mono_users&amp;amp;rev=1168201511">
        <dc:format>text/html</dc:format>
        <dc:date>2007-01-07T21:25:11+01:00</dc:date>
        <title>core:phalanger_for_mono_users</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aphalanger_for_mono_users&amp;amp;rev=1168201511</link>
        <description>What is Phalanger?

Project Phalanger is PHP language compiler for the .NET Framework platform and starting from the 2.0 version also for the Mono platform. Phalanger was originally developed only for .NET (part of the version 1.0 was written in Managed C++), but one of the goals of the 2.0 version is full Mono support and ability to execute PHP applications on the Apache web server (using the mod-mono module). Phalanger is developed under the Shared Source license, which allows its modification…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aphalanger_for_php_developers&amp;amp;rev=1167358267">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:phalanger_for_php_developers</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aphalanger_for_php_developers&amp;amp;rev=1167358267</link>
        <description>Comming soon!</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aphalanger_net_screenshot&amp;amp;rev=1168202883">
        <dc:format>text/html</dc:format>
        <dc:date>2007-01-07T21:48:03+01:00</dc:date>
        <title>core:phalanger_net_screenshot</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aphalanger_net_screenshot&amp;amp;rev=1168202883</link>
        <description>[Visual Studio debugging] (Click on the image for larger version)

Back to Phalanger for .Net Developers</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aphp-in-vs2008&amp;amp;rev=1205290479">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:php-in-vs2008</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aphp-in-vs2008&amp;amp;rev=1205290479</link>
        <description>At the Lang.NET Symposium we presented several new features in Phalanger. You can find the presentation and samples on Tomas Petricek’s blog here  and the talk is also available as a video on the Lang.NET web site here. The most interesting thing is that I’ve used Phalanger Integration for Visual Studio 2008 during the talk, which wasn’t available in any Phalanger release until now.</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aphpbb-benchmark&amp;amp;rev=1166235376">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:phpbb-benchmark</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aphpbb-benchmark&amp;amp;rev=1166235376</link>
        <description>Written by: Ladislav Prosek

With all those improvements that we have made to Phalanger v2.0, I was very curious about its performance. Many people suspected us for cheating when we claimed that Phalanger v1.0 can run common web applications twice as fast than if the PHP interpreter is used. That’s why I’m going to publish this article which explains all steps involved in my benchmarking rather than just the results. The procedure described here should be easily reproducible and I encourage you …</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aprevious-version&amp;amp;rev=1166284911">
        <dc:format>text/html</dc:format>
        <dc:date>2006-12-16T17:01:51+01:00</dc:date>
        <title>core:previous-version</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aprevious-version&amp;amp;rev=1166284911</link>
        <description>If you are interested in the Phalanger 1.0, visit the original web site at &lt;http://v1.php-compiler.net&gt;

From the Phalanger 1.0 web site

Introduction

The Phalanger is a complex solution giving web-application developers the ability to benefit from both the ease-of-use and effectiveness of the PHP language and the power and richness of the .NET platform. This solution enables developers to painlessly deploy and run existing PHP code on an ASP.NET web server and develop cross-platform extensions…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3aroadmap&amp;amp;rev=1177249624">
        <dc:format>text/html</dc:format>
        <dc:date>2007-04-22T14:47:04+01:00</dc:date>
        <title>core:roadmap</title>
        <link>http://phpcompiler.net/doku.php?id=core%3aroadmap&amp;amp;rev=1177249624</link>
        <description>We’re still working on determinating dates and priorities for our roadmap. Please use the suggestions page to comment the roadmap and submit your ideas regarding Phalanger. The list of things that we’d like to work on:

Long-term goals

	*  Implementing all features described in the PHP/CLR specification 
		*  Implementing property accessors (getters/setters)
		*  Implement global constants 
		*  Support for CLR arrays and indexers
		*  Support “+=” event syntax
		*  LINQ over in-memory data
		*…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3asidebar&amp;amp;rev=1166840036">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:sidebar</title>
        <link>http://phpcompiler.net/doku.php?id=core%3asidebar&amp;amp;rev=1166840036</link>
        <description>Phalanger project

	*  Home page
	*  Project overview
	*  Features
	*  Benchmarks
	*  Papers&amp;talks
	*  Roadmap&amp;changes
	*  Previous version
	*  Authors

CodePlex links

Binary releases
 Source releases
 Phalanger Forums
 Bug tracker
 License
 Phalanger MySQL</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3astart&amp;amp;rev=1268428153">
        <dc:format>text/html</dc:format>
        <dc:date>2010-03-12T22:09:13+01:00</dc:date>
        <title>core:start</title>
        <link>http://phpcompiler.net/doku.php?id=core%3astart&amp;amp;rev=1268428153</link>
        <description>Latest News

	*  12 March 2010: In case you are interested in contributing to Phalanger, here is a page with several project ideas. Also you can join the Phalanger community first for more information.
	*  21 December 2009: Thanks to DEVSENSE (&lt;http://www.devsense.com/&gt;) and Jadu (&lt;http://www.jadu.co.uk/&gt;) companies our team are again actively working on Phalanger. The new release is coming soon (actual state is available in Source Code section &lt;http://phalanger.codeplex.com/SourceControl/list/c…</description>
    </item>
    <item rdf:about="http://phpcompiler.net/doku.php?id=core%3atalks&amp;amp;rev=1166241246">
        <dc:format>text/html</dc:format>
        <dc:date>1970-01-01T00:00:00+01:00</dc:date>
        <title>core:talks</title>
        <link>http://phpcompiler.net/doku.php?id=core%3atalks&amp;amp;rev=1166241246</link>
        <description>Year 2006

Phalanger: Compiling and Running PHP Applications on the Microsoft .NET Platform

  Jan Benda, Tomas Matousek, Ladislav Prosek, 2006.  (.NET Technologies 2006 conference full paper.)
 Download: Paper: , conference presentation: 

Abstract: This paper addresses major issues related to compilation of applications written in the PHP language and their solutions proposed and implemented in the Phalanger system targeting the Microsoft .NET platform. Main focus is given to those PHP feature…</description>
    </item>
</rdf:RDF>
